Poker Face Season 2 Unfolds Complex FBI Mole Plot Across Safe Houses
Poker Face Season 2 continues to follow Natasha Lyonne's character, Charlie Cale, as she navigates new mysteries while on the run from mob boss Beatrix Hasp, who previously gave her an ultimatum. The show maintains its signature format of revealing the murderer early, similar to Columbo, and features a rotating cast of notable guest stars such as Cynthia Erivo, Giancarlo Esposito, Katie Holmes, John Mulaney, and Steve Buscemi, who voices a recurring character known as "Good Buddy." Episode 3 centers on Beatrix and her gang dealing with internal betrayal and an FBI ambush, while Episode 2 features a murder mystery set against a film shoot in a funeral home, showcasing the show's blend of crime and dark drama. The series' casting team carefully selects high-profile guest stars to keep the episodes fresh and engaging, with secrecy around character details to maintain suspense. Showrunner Tony Tost highlights Buscemi's role as a comforting presence for Charlie, rather than a major plot player, emphasizing the show's focus on episodic storytelling with new characters each week. Overall, Poker Face Season 2 continues to blend mystery, crime, and celebrity guest appearances, sustaining the show's appeal for fans of the genre.
